Transaction 756e528566ec0b440c1713018b345e083a58cf13d0be89d89d6b7a386d611aad
1 Input
1 Output
-
756e528566ec0b440c1713018b345e083a58cf13d0be89d89d6b7a386d611aad:0
- value
- 648350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 890062c90755bc5025c517eb2832d49f76e6c2fc OP_EQUAL
- address
- 3EBQxdqXLLLCRcVYiBA134ETdXjrRXcYur